Transaction f43da86e1859f44b478e765fc79c995f55c14a6bc5d8b0b35f5bcb27fb4aa874

2 Input
2 Outputs
  • f43da86e1859f44b478e765fc79c995f55c14a6bc5d8b0b35f5bcb27fb4aa874:0
  • value  449791380
    address  3Mq621r8EB3Ct7Fu7QWn21CJrSpiCrPL9S
  • f43da86e1859f44b478e765fc79c995f55c14a6bc5d8b0b35f5bcb27fb4aa874:1
  • value  282896500
    address  397APuXmRtPEgLUWe1moFUjF4KNDn7xfmy